Abstract
The principle of reciprocity is considered as a means for increasing rights enjoyed by foreigners in the territory of the state, and realizing equality between them and their nationals, citizens or subjects in the field of the legal position or status of foreigners. It is worth-bearing in mind that this principle is sub-categorized according to the source from which it is established, and in conformity with its content or context. This principle is arising from three main sources, that is to say, international treaties and conventions, legislations and both the judiciary and customs.
